One of the biggest reasons I finally made the switch was for upgrading or migrating to Windows 11. Microsoft made it pretty clear: Windows 11 absolutely requires a UEFI-based system with a GPT partition style. If your disk was still MBR, like mine was, you simply couldn't install it. The conversion process is the key to unlocking that upgrade. But it's not just about Windows 11. If you're building a new PC or upgrading an existing one, installing Windows on UEFI-based computers is the modern standard, offering faster boot times and better security features. MBR disks are tied to the older Legacy BIOS, so converting to GPT is essential to fully utilize your modern hardware. Another huge benefit, especially for those of us with lots of files or large media libraries, is the ability to use disks larger than 2TB. MBR has a hard limit at 2TB, meaning any space beyond that is simply unusable. GPT completely bypasses this, letting you take advantage of those massive drives. Plus, if you're someone who likes to organize your storage with many partitions, MBR's limit of only four primary partitions can be a real headache. GPT, on the other hand, allows for up to 128 primary partitions, giving you so much more flexibility. So, if you've seen messages like 'boot partition not set to gpt' or 'windows cannot be installed to this disk the selected disk is of the gpt partition style' (or the MBR equivalent), it's usually because your system setup (UEFI vs. Legacy BIOS) isn't matching your disk's partition style (GPT vs. MBR). Converting your disk to GPT allows you to install Windows in UEFI mode, which resolves these common installation roadblocks. And yes, this applies whether you're using a traditional HDD or a speedy SSD! Many of you might be wondering 'how to change ssd from mbr to gpt' – the methods discussed here work perfectly for both. The great news is that there are reliable ways to perform this conversion, like using the built-in MBR2GPT tool or professional software like AOMEI Partition Assistant, all without losing data. Just remember that after you convert, you'll need to hop into your BIOS settings and switch your boot mode from Legacy to UEFI to ensure everything boots up correctly.
